TFIIH p62 rabbit pAb
- Description: Function: Component of the core-TFIIH basal transcription factor involved in nucleotide excision repair (NER) of DNA and, when complexed to CAK, in RNA transcription by RNA polymerase II. PTM: Phosphorylated. similarity: Contains 2 BSD domains. subunit: One of the six subunits forming the core-TFIIH basal transcription factor. Interacts with PUF60.
